A basic moisturizer primarily adds hydration to the skin's surface. This cream is formulated with a specific focus on mature skin that has become drier, less elastic, and more prone to visible lines. Its core idea is to work with the skin's own structure, using protein building blocks that are common in anti-age cosmetics. These ingredients are intended to help the skin hold moisture better over time, which can make fine lines caused by dryness less noticeable. Additionally, the active ingredients are meant to counter the visible effects of mechanical skin aging—the gradual wear from facial expressions, rubbing, and external stress that basic moisturizers don't specifically address. The paraffin-free, lighter base also differs from heavier occlusive creams, aiming to leave skin feeling supple without a coated film. It's a cosmetic step chosen when skin needs more than simple hydration, particularly for areas exposed to friction and temperature changes.
